Make a court reservation View current classes. WebWhile these are the actual court dimensions, they do not make up the total playing area in pickleball. For casual and open play, the court and its surrounding space should measure 30’ wide by 60’ in length. In competitive and tournament play, the preferred dimensions are 34’ wide by 64’ in length.
